About the Role

We are seeking a Clinical Nurse Manager for our Paediatric Ward at Te Whatu Ora Taranaki. This 1.0 FTE fixed-term parental leave cover role offers an excellent opportunity to lead a dedicated paediatric nursing team in a busy inpatient setting.

As Clinical Nurse Manager, you will provide clinical, professional, and operational leadership to ensure the delivery of safe, effective, and high-quality care. You’ll work closely with the Senior Nursing team, medical staff, service and operational managers, and the wider multidisciplinary team to support service delivery, workforce planning, and continuous improvement initiatives.

This role is well supported with a comprehensive orientation and induction programme and is ideally suited to a nurse with advanced paediatric experience and proven leadership capability who enjoys navigating complex environments and driving positive change.

About you

· Current registration with the Nursing Council of New Zealand and a current APC

· Minimum of 5 years’ post-graduate nursing experience in Paediatrics (Expert Nursing portfolio desirable)

· Proven leadership experience with advanced paediatric clinical expertise

· Strong problem-solving, communication, and interpersonal skills

· Experience or knowledge of quality improvement, with the ability to lead quality projects

· Understanding of nursing legislation in New Zealand

· Knowledge of Te Tiriti o Waitangi and a commitment to bicultural practice

· Ability to work collaboratively in an interdisciplinary team and manage competing priorities in a changing environment
